The Civil War is the background for this book, particularly the blood massacre of men, women, and children by William Clark Quantrell in Lawrence, Kansas in 1863. Frank Gruber even writes a preface in the book detailing the source for the material for this book. The story of Donny Fletcher is fiction, however history--depending on your bias--perhaps does contain such an incident--that of Fletcher facing execution by the Army for killing a man--flees home to Missouri. There he joins Quantrell in his campaigns of the war, until Lawrence, Kansas turned into a massacre. It was then Flether had to make the toughest decision of his life....This is an extraordinary book with plenty of action, plenty of history, and plenty of entertainment value. Frank Gruber knew how to tell a story with scenes shifting from place to place and people to people with rapid fire percision to get his story told. He is a one of a kind of author.
